I got my used Mazda last year in August and after a short while I noticed that it hesitates when accelerating, especially uphill.

So far I have checked and done the following:
1. Changed my spark plugs.
2. Changed my air filter.
3. Changed my fuel pump.
4. Moded my catalytic converter (put straight pipe).
5. Cleaned the throttle position sensor, air flow sensor.
i have also had my car checked on a diagnosis machine twice and no errors have showed up. None of the above solutions have worked
